Transaction ecd384b73f430282cc1eb6a0f70c6a4c9be4ca62ac46c44bfe6de612cc4cb12e
1 Input
1 Output
-
ecd384b73f430282cc1eb6a0f70c6a4c9be4ca62ac46c44bfe6de612cc4cb12e:0
- value
- 2085526
- script pubkey
- OP_0 OP_PUSHBYTES_20 be42e752986737cac81455e482eac5f11962f8c8
- address
- bc1qhepww55cvumu4jq52hjg96k97yvk97xgw33tua